Package: ifupdown
Version: 0.7.52
Severity: important

Dear Maintainer,

I decided to split interfaces(5) and extracted one interface into separate
file in interfaces.d/brsys. gdb ifup segfaults...:

(gdb) run brsys
Starting program: /sbin/ifup brsys

Program received signal SIGSEGV, Segmentation fault.
internal_fnmatch (pattern=pattern@entry=0x60f3ea "*", 
    string=string@entry=0x12dfd43 "brsys", string_end=0x12dfd48 "", 
    no_leading_period=no_leading_period@entry=4, flags=flags@entry=4, 
    ends=ends@entry=0x0, alloca_used=alloca_used@entry=0) at fnmatch_loop.c:49
49      fnmatch_loop.c: No such file or directory.
(gdb) bt
#0  internal_fnmatch (pattern=pattern@entry=0x60f3ea "*", 
    string=string@entry=0x12dfd43 "brsys", string_end=0x12dfd48 "", 
    no_leading_period=no_leading_period@entry=4, flags=flags@entry=4, 
    ends=ends@entry=0x0, alloca_used=alloca_used@entry=0) at fnmatch_loop.c:49
#1  0x00007ffff7af2343 in __fnmatch (pattern=pattern@entry=0x60f3ea "*", 
    string=string@entry=0x12dfd43 "brsys", flags=flags@entry=4) at fnmatch.c:454
#2  0x00007ffff7aed082 in glob_in_dir (pattern=pattern@entry=0x60f3ea "*", 
    directory=directory@entry=0x7fffff7ffc60 "/etc/network/interfaces.d", 
flags=272, 
    flags@entry=16, errfunc=errfunc@entry=0x0, 
pglob=pglob@entry=0x7fffff7fffb0, 
    alloca_used=576, alloca_used@entry=48) at ../posix/glob.c:1607
#3  0x00007ffff7aee1ba in __GI_glob (pattern=<optimized out>, 
flags=flags@entry=16, 
    errfunc=errfunc@entry=0x0, pglob=pglob@entry=0x7fffff7fffb0)
    at ../posix/glob.c:1191
#4  0x00007ffff7b0aace in do_parse_glob (ifs_white=<optimized out>, 
    ifs=0x7fffff7fff60 " \t\n", pwordexp=0x7fffff8000c0, 
max_length=0x7fffff7fff80, 
    word_length=0x7fffff7fff78, word=0x7fffff7fff88, glob_word=<optimized out>)
    at wordexp.c:391
#5  parse_glob (ifs_white=0x7fffff7fff60 " \t\n", ifs=0x7fffff7fff60 " \t\n", 
    pwordexp=0x7fffff8000c0, flags=4, offset=0x7fffff7fff70, 
    words=0x12d91a0 "/etc/network/interfaces.d/*", max_length=0x7fffff7fff80, 
    word_length=0x7fffff7fff78, word=0x7fffff7fff88) at wordexp.c:525
#6  wordexp (words=<optimized out>, pwordexp=0x7fffff8000c0, flags=4) at 
wordexp.c:2416
#7  0x0000000000405fe4 in ?? ()
#8  0x0000000000406023 in ?? ()
#9  0x0000000000406023 in ?? ()
#10 0x0000000000406023 in ?? ()
---Type <return> to continue, or q <return> to quit---
#11 0x0000000000406023 in ?? ()
#12 0x0000000000406023 in ?? ()
#13 0x0000000000406023 in ?? ()
#14 0x0000000000406023 in ?? ()
#15 0x0000000000406023 in ?? ()
#16 0x0000000000406023 in ?? ()
#17 0x0000000000406023 in ?? ()
#18 0x0000000000406023 in ?? ()
#19 0x0000000000406023 in ?? ()
#20 0x0000000000406023 in ?? ()
#21 0x0000000000406023 in ?? ()
#22 0x0000000000406023 in ?? ()
...



-- System Information:
Debian Release: 8.0
  APT prefers testing
  APT policy: (500, 'testing')
Architecture: amd64 (x86_64)

Kernel: Linux 3.16.0-4-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)

Versions of packages ifupdown depends on:
ii  adduser      3.113+nmu3
ii  initscripts  2.88dsf-58
ii  iproute2     3.16.0-2
ii  libc6        2.19-15
ii  lsb-base     4.1+Debian13+nmu1

Versions of packages ifupdown recommends:
ii  isc-dhcp-client [dhcp-client]  4.3.1-6

Versions of packages ifupdown suggests:
ii  net-tools  1.60-26+b1
pn  ppp        <none>
pn  rdnssd     <none>

-- no debconf information


-- 
To UNSUBSCRIBE, email to [email protected]
with a subject of "unsubscribe". Trouble? Contact [email protected]

Reply via email to